Holiday Bedroom

Your bedroom might be the last place you think to decorate for Christmas, but hopefully, I can change your mind about that! *wink* Do you have a Christmas tree in your bedroom? Y’all, one of my favorite things to do during the Christmas season is to sleep in my cozy bed and leave the tree lights on. It revives nostalgia and brings back the magic of Christmas I felt as a child. This North Pole Trading Co. Flannel Sheet Set is this cozy bedding base. Bedroom From Christmas Past

Each year, I usually only make small changes here and there. Updating your bedding is a game changer; it can elevate the feel of Christmas in your room. In the first picture, I used a similar Flannel Duvet Cover for my bedding and love how it turned out. It matches my wrapping paper!  I added a flocked Christmas tree in the corner that lights up beautifully. The last small detail is this Wood Bead Garland I have draped over the canvas above my bed. After decorating elsewhere in my house, I had some extra lying around and thought this was the perfect spot.

My room on the right is very simple and elegant and is from a few years ago (right after I moved in my cottage). If you are not into all the reds and bright colors of the holidays, this is a simpler design that can work in your home. I used my beige comforter and added touches of greenery throughout my room. I didn’t want to add a grand tree in here since the rest of the space is so simple, so I went a simple tree like this Rock Pine Artificial Christmas Tree. It has lots of empty space in between the branches, which works well here. Last but not least, I added a tin tub similar to this adorable Tin Christmas Tree Collar

Christmas Bathroom

The last stop on this holiday home tour is the bathroom! It didn’t take much to make to turn this space into a Christmas wonderland. All you need is a few matching towel bath sets that are Christmas-themed, such as these Christmas in the Country Guest Towels. I added a few personal touches with this Emibele Christmas Tree Lotion Dispenser because it matches the towels! I added a few plants here to highlight the red and green colors, which turned out perfectly. Last but not least, (and you might have noticed by now *wink*), but I like to add a wreath to almost every room to top it off. 

This is a special time of the year to celebrate with friends and family; celebrating is always more fun in a festive home. I always re-use pieces I have collected over the years and try and switch up the styles to see what I come up with. My biggest tip for Christmas decor shopping is to find more significant pieces that stand out in a room; this is not the holiday to be subtle!
